What Affects Residential & Commercial Roofing Costs in Minooka?
Understanding pricing factors helps you budget accurately and avoid surprises
labor costs
Labor rates in Minooka and Grundy County typically reflect the broader Chicagoland market, though they may be slightly lower than in more urban areas. Skilled roofing crews are in demand, especially during peak seasons, which can affect pricing. Local union rates and contractor availability also play significant roles in labor costs.
market dynamics
The roofing market in Minooka experiences steady demand due to the area's mix of residential and commercial properties. Competition among established roofing companies helps moderate pricing, but material availability and supply chain factors can cause fluctuations. Insurance work from storm damage also influences local market pricing throughout the year.
seasonal trends
Roofing costs in Minooka often increase during late spring through early fall when demand is highest. Winter months may offer more competitive pricing, though weather limitations can affect project timelines. Post-storm periods following severe weather events typically see increased demand and potentially higher pricing due to urgent repair needs.

💬 What's the biggest factor affecting roofing costs in Minooka?
Material choice and roof complexity typically have the most significant impact on pricing. Higher-quality materials like architectural shingles or metal roofing cost more than basic three-tab shingles. Complex roof designs with multiple valleys, dormers, or steep pitches require more labor and expertise, increasing overall costs.
💬 How does commercial roofing pricing differ from residential in Minooka?
Commercial roofing often involves different materials (EPDM, TPO, metal), larger scale projects, and specialized installation requirements. Pricing structures may include different labor rates, equipment needs, and project management considerations. Commercial projects also frequently require different permitting and compliance processes than residential work.

💬 What should I look for in a roofing warranty in Minooka?
Look for comprehensive warranties that cover both materials and workmanship. Manufacturer warranties vary by product, while contractor workmanship warranties typically range from 1-10 years. Ensure warranties are transferable if you sell your property and understand what circumstances might void coverage, such as improper maintenance or unauthorized repairs.
